Фронтенд-разработчик | frontend developer это

Фронтенд-разработчик – это специалист, который отвечает за создание пользовательского интерфейса и взаимодействие с пользователем на веб-сайте или веб-приложении. Он занимается разработкой клиентской части, которая отображается в браузере пользователя.

Обязанности фронтенд-разработчика могут варьироваться в зависимости от проекта и компании, но в общих чертах они включают:

1. Разработка пользовательского интерфейса: Фронтенд-разработчик создает веб-страницы, формы, графику и другие элементы интерфейса, которые пользователь видит и с которыми взаимодействует.

2. Верстка: Фронтенд-разработчик отвечает за создание HTML, CSS и JavaScript кода, который отображает и оформляет содержимое веб-страницы.

3. Создание адаптивного дизайна: Фронтенд-разработчик обеспечивает, чтобы веб-сайт или приложение хорошо выглядели и работали на разных устройствах и экранах – от компьютеров до мобильных устройств.

4. Взаимодействие с бэкендом: Фронтенд-разработчик интегрирует взаимодействие с серверной частью (бэкендом), отправляет и получает данные с помощью AJAX, REST API и других методов связи.

5. Оптимизация производительности: Фронтенд-разработчик оптимизирует код и ресурсы для улучшения скорости загрузки веб-страницы и улучшения пользовательского опыта.

Для выполнения своих обязанностей фронтенд-разработчики используют различные инструменты и технологии, такие как HTML, CSS, JavaScript, фреймворки (например, React, Angular, Vue.js), инструменты разработки (например, npm, webpack) и другие.

Успешный фронтенд-разработчик должен иметь хорошее понимание пользовательского опыта, владеть основными языками и технологиями веб-разработки, а также уметь работать в команде и применять лучшие практики в разработке интерфейсов.

Работает на BetterDocs